Transaction

86f0d02d6d8a0de99bd9713fed7d3cfa83d94561e9876e1301015d4e65a3cfda
117,992 confirmations
Timestamp
1701658661
Block819,673
Fee25,532 sats
Fee rate52.1 sats/vB
view on mempool.space

Inputs & Outputs